金秋消费活力涌动 申城十一假期商圈“花式”促销打造多元体验新场景
Sou Hu Cai Jing· 2025-09-27 13:05
Group 1 - The upcoming National Day Golden Week is expected to boost Shanghai's consumption market, with various retail enterprises launching aggressive promotional strategies to stimulate consumer activity [1][3] - Retailers like Bailian Group are offering substantial discounts and unique promotions, such as the "National Day Draw for Gold" event, which has gained popularity on social media [3] - Supermarkets are also providing significant subsidies and special offers on daily necessities, enhancing the festive dining experience for consumers [3] Group 2 - Consumers are increasingly seeking immersive experiences rather than just shopping, leading to the introduction of unique cultural and entertainment events targeting younger demographics [4] - Events like the "Human is Too Good" exhibition and family-oriented charity sales are blending commerce with cultural and social initiatives, enriching the consumer experience [4] - The integration of cultural arts into commercial spaces is transforming shopping areas into platforms showcasing the city's soft power [4] Group 3 - The "Second Shanghai International Light and Shadow Festival" is contributing to the development of the night economy, with various shopping centers implementing light shows and extending operating hours [6] - The First Department Store is utilizing 3D light technology to create visually striking experiences, enhancing nighttime shopping and dining options for visitors [6] Group 4 - Marketing activities are extending beyond stores to public spaces, creating a city-wide atmosphere of consumption, with promotional materials visible in transit areas and themed buses enhancing visibility [8] - Online platforms are also playing a crucial role in driving traffic to physical stores by offering holiday gift boxes and coupons, facilitating a synchronized online and offline shopping experience [8] - The diverse offerings from Shanghai's commercial enterprises are meeting the growing demand for quality and experiential consumption among consumers [8]
